Output 265c53df836e0b5aad4558f0b031440748eaaead42e00d8f8220eb3fc66dc075:7

value
2584276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524245210f4f9274849b1542b97427d279ffe20a OP_EQUAL
address
9ywDTeE61C83zr3kNF3tRjMykkaTGgrCqD
transaction
265c53df836e0b5aad4558f0b031440748eaaead42e00d8f8220eb3fc66dc075